Transaction 20fc70dacb9a532eeb09d5224ee0a81d2d52e323883eb4b96de65ecf02a37de5
1 Input
2 Outputs
- 20fc70dacb9a532eeb09d5224ee0a81d2d52e323883eb4b96de65ecf02a37de5:0
- 20fc70dacb9a532eeb09d5224ee0a81d2d52e323883eb4b96de65ecf02a37de5:1
value 5980026
address 33Wha1bA7nK2rwkKB8TiTLxzvpn1jF4cpn
value 526639
address 1Pf7AVgMo9MCDjJqjJk9Z2nqqytXC3Dcaa